Output 357a2a8c41fc6ee56b816e7959533e43ea61f435b23fb6071fa91516cc98820d:0

value
652314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e234dca261ad8f5617c16d7ad5a94cf90c85f75 OP_EQUAL
address
3EeaAjqAXPVMMh834HJ9ombouxrSn3yYy1
transaction
357a2a8c41fc6ee56b816e7959533e43ea61f435b23fb6071fa91516cc98820d
spent
true